Fourth Graders Sing at Mets Game!

Rippowam Cisqua fourth graders sang the national anthem at Citi Field on Monday, May 3 -- what a way to start the game!



The students had been practicing The Star-Spangled Banner with music teacher Lainie Zades for months, but more that one fourth grader admitted after the performance that it wasn’t easy singing in front of such a huge audience! Parents and friends cheered the students from the stands -- the enthusiasm both on and off the field was huge, and all agreed that the singing was superb. Click HERE to watch a video! 

A special thanks to Lower Campus teachers Penny Cataldo, Kimberly Fox, and Amanda Goodman, who sang with the fourth graders, and also Ms. Zades, for not only leading on Monday night, but all through the year in the music room!
